Leaves Are Falling
Leaves are falling and have drifted into piles, burnt orange and yellow, burgundy twirling; as Autumn's breeze make them dance, glittering and dipping in a swirling waltz; and now the trees lay down their emerald gowns, last night Jack Frost rattled my windows; oh there was a mighty blizzard of falling snow, in front of the fireplace I stayed warm and cozy; and in the night winter had arrived, morning dazzled and was full of sweet twittering. Everything looked so beautiful and magical, the forest path was calling for me to come; those places that once held leaves now held white, above the sky was azure blue with flakes; moving, billowing, expanding and drifting, ever changing and that sun was so soothing; I wrapped my cozy coat around me tighter, soon, I came to the park and my special place; little frozen crystals hung from branches, and in my reverie- I was skating on an icy pond. ________________________ August 26, 2016 Poetry/Verse/Leaves Are Falling Copyright Protected, ID 16-823-476-0 All Rights Reserved.
